One of the most popular and widely used app on the iOS devices has got a minor update today! Facebook 3.3.2 for iPhone brings access to account & privacy settings, along with Facebook Help Center so that you can access them all right from the app. It also brings various bug fixes, including a fix for bug that prevented users from uploading photos to specific albums.

Probably the most easiest way to install Android on an iPhone 2G/3G is via iPhoDroid, which we did cover previously. But the problem with it is; you should have a computer to run the whole process of installing Android on your iPhone 2G/3G. But thanks to Bootlace 2.1, you can now install Android 2.2.1 Froyo on your jailbroken iPhone without needing to connect it to any PC or Mac!
